Summary

Join me and Dr. Julie Fratantoni, a neuroscientist and brain health expert, as we discussed healthy habits for our heads. Julie received her PhD in Cognitive Neuroscience from The University of Texas at Dallas. she is a licensed Speech Language Pathologist, trained in biofeedback, a 200 hr certified yoga instructor and trained in breathing and mindfulness techniques. Here work focuses on how to improve brain performance and extend cognitive longevity.
